An out-of-work ronin arrives at the manor of local feudal Lord Iyi, requesting his permission to commit ritualistic suicide on the property. Lord Iyi’s clansmen are doubtful of the ronin’s integrity, believing he is merely seeking charity. The ronin uses the opportunity to share the events and circumstances that led to this fateful moment, with the hopes of finding a worthy second to deliver his final death blow.
Winner of the Cannes Film Festival Special Jury Prize and starring the late Tatsuya Nakadai, Masaki Kobayashi’s critically acclaimed HARAKIRI remains one of the greatest samurai films of all time. Its interlocking stories serve as a poignant exploration of the Samurai code and a powerful depiction of one’s agency in the face of a corrupt, unjust system.
